India 82 for 3 at lunch on Day 1

Electing to bat, India were 82 for three in their first innings at lunch on the opening day of the first cricket Test against South Africa, here today.
Opener Murali Vijay (40) and Ajinkya Rahane (3) were at the crease for the hosts when the break was taken.
Brief Scores:
India 1st innings: 80 for 3 in 27 overs. (M Vijay 40 batting, C Pujara 31; D Elgar 1/3).
